MG21/21E Datasheet

Connectivity is critical for any organization that depends on reliable internet access in order to function. Wireless WAN connectivity options, such as cellular
networks, serve as a reliable backup internet uplink in the event of a primary uplink failure.

The MG21 cellular gateway simplifies the path to wireless WAN connectivity and makes cellular a viable uplink option for many networks. The MG21 acts as a
gateway to cellular networks by converting LTE signal from a cellular provider to an Ethernet handoff, which can be used as an internet uplink for a variety of
use-cases.

Use Cases
Note that the following use-cases refer to using a Meraki MX appliance with the MG21 as a WAN uplink. However, the use-cases can also apply to non-Meraki
devices.

• Antenna placement where cellular coverage is best


◦ Signal strength is key for cellular performance. The MG21 makes cellular a viable option in situations where the
best location for the MX is not necessarily the best location for a strong cellular signal. The separation of
cellular antenna and MX expands cellular options for all networks, particularly for mid-range MXs mounted in a
data center.
• Primary WAN
◦ In areas where wired internet services are not available, the MG21 provides a simple, viable option for wireless
WAN connectivity.
• Secondary WAN for Failover
◦ An MX's secondary WAN interface connected to an MG21 may use the cellular network in the event of a
primary uplink failure.
• Secondary WAN for SD-WAN
◦ An MX with an MG21 as a secondary WAN uplink may use the cellular network to establish VPNs for SD-WAN.
• High Availability Uplink
◦ The MG21 can be used as either a primary or secondary internet uplink for MX HA topologies. Its two LAN
ports allow the MXs to share access to the same cellular network.

Carrier compatibility is based on Meraki device certifications being approved by the carrier. Although Meraki can test networks and many unlisted carriers may
be functionally compatible with Meraki devices, the list of certified carriers is based on the carrier validating Meraki, and not the other way around.

Please note that until certification has been obtained, the MG21 will not work on Verizon's network.

Ordering Guide
To place an order for an MG cellular gateway, pair a specific hardware model with a single license (which includes cloud services, software upgrades and
support). For example, to order an an MG21E with 3 years of enterprise licensing for use in North America, order an MG21E-HW-NA with LIC-MG21-ENT-3Y. A
lifetime warranty with advanced replacement is included on all MG hardware (excluding accessories) at no additional cost.

Note: Non-Meraki antennas are not supported. The socket is a reversed RP-SMA that is designed to detect the official MG smart dipole antennas
and smart patch antenna. Usage of non-Meraki accessories may damage the MG and degrade performance. The Cisco Meraki antennas
are designed for the maximum allowable gain without exceeding the EIRP for local regulatory domains on their supported bands.
